Chinese Car Brands Middle East: Dealer Network Expansion 2026

A car brand is only as good as its service network. Chinese manufacturers understand this and are investing heavily in dealer expansion, service centres, and parts warehousing across the Middle East. This guide maps the current and planned dealer footprint of every major Chinese brand in the GCC, covering showroom counts, service centre locations, parts infrastructure, and coverage beyond major cities.

Dealer network density directly affects your ownership experience: how far you must travel for warranty service, how quickly parts arrive, and whether you have a local authorised repair option. This comparison shows which brands have built the most comprehensive after-sales infrastructure and which are still catching up — information that should influence your purchase decision alongside price and specifications.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many Chinese car dealers are in the Middle East?

There are 95 GCC Chinese brand showrooms as of H1 2026, up from 52 in 2024. The breakdown by country is: UAE 28, KSA 35, Kuwait 12, Qatar 8, Oman 7, and Bahrain 5. MG leads with 22 dealers, followed by BYD (15), Changan (12), Haval/GWM (12), Jetour (8), Chery (7), Geely (7), and Tank (6). This represents an 83% increase in showroom count in just two years, reflecting the pace of Chinese brand expansion across the region.

Which Chinese brand is expanding dealers fastest?

BYD is expanding the fastest, having opened 8 new showrooms across the GCC in 2025-2026. BYD plans 5 more by the end of 2026, targeting a total of 20 showrooms. The expansion is focused on Abu Dhabi, Al Ain, Dammam, and Muscat to complement existing Dubai and Riyadh coverage. BYD is also investing in 3 dedicated EV service centres and 2 parts warehouses, recognising that EV ownership requires specialised service infrastructure beyond standard showrooms.

Do Chinese brands have service centres outside major cities?

Yes, and coverage is expanding. MG has service centres in Al Ain, Sohar, and Dammam. Haval operates in Ras Al Khaimah and Abha. BYD plans to open service centres in Al Ain and Fujairah by Q4 2026. Changan has locations in Sharjah and Ajman. MG has also launched mobile service units for truly remote areas. Parts delivery to remote locations typically takes 48-72 hours, which is improving as regional parts warehouses come online in Dubai, Riyadh, and Doha.

Chinese Car Dealer Expansion Market Data Middle East 2026

The total Chinese brand GCC showroom count reached 95 in H1 2026, an 83% increase from 52 in 2024. This expansion outpaced sales growth of 52% over the same period, indicating that brands are investing in infrastructure ahead of demand — a deliberate strategy to build buyer confidence and reduce the service-bottleneck risk that has historically held back Chinese car adoption in the region.

Saudi Arabia hosts 35 Chinese brand showrooms, the most of any GCC country, followed by the UAE with 28. KSA's larger geography and Vision 2030 economic reforms make it the primary expansion target, with BYD, MG, and Changan all prioritising Dammam, Jeddah, and secondary cities like Abha and Tabuk for their next wave of openings.

Parts warehousing remains a bottleneck. Only MG and BYD operate two regional warehouses each, while most other brands rely on a single Dubai-based facility. This means parts delivery to remote areas in Oman, southern KSA, and the UAE Northern Emirates can take 48-72 hours. The planned opening of additional warehouses in Riyadh and Doha by end of 2026 is expected to reduce this to 24-48 hours for 90% of the GCC population.
